90 out of 95 tests in a Michigan prison for the highly contagious version of COVID in the UK have returned positive

Ionia, Michigan – Michigan officials said Tuesday that at least 90 cases of the highly contagious variant COVID-19 first identified in the UK have been confirmed in a prison here. Officials from the Department of Health and Human Services said only five of the 95 tests administered did not test positive.

Moreover, the results of another 100 tests at the Bellamy Creek Correction Center were still pending as of late Tuesday night.

All but two of the two people who tested positive were detained. The other two were staff members, officials said.

The testing was started in prison after it was found that an employee has the option.

But officials pointed out that the number of positive COVIDA results began to decline with the start of daily testing.

Additional precautions against COVID were implemented at the facility as soon as the variant was found there, officials added. Daily testing was one of the new steps.
